Solutions Strategy Manager

Nambassa Nakatudde is responsible for working with our global institutional investor client base to design and implement innovative solutions. Nambassa joined L&G’s Asset Management business in 2024, from Allspring Global Investments (Wells Fargo Asset Management), where she was a Senior Solutions Analyst with a similar focus. Prior to that, she was Lead Investment Associate at Willis Towers Watson in the Insurance Investment Team.  Nambassa holds an MSc Statistics from the London School of Economics, as well as an MA African Studies from SOAS University of London, is a CFA Charterholder and holds the CFA Certificate in ESG investing.
